“An apple a day keeps the doctor away,” as the saying goes. You have heard it somewhere. Should you, however, strive to avoid seeing a healthcare provider? Even if you feel well, establishing a connection with a primary care provider is a much better way to take a proactive approach to your healthcare. If you have nothing planned for Valentine’s Day, why not treat yourself to a check-up at your local family clinic in Las Vegas, Nevada?

Primary care physicians treat acute and chronic illnesses, specialize in disease prevention and diagnosis, encourage health maintenance, and educate patients. There is no better Valentine’s Day gift for yourself than a check-up on your health!

They serve as the front door to health care systems, ensuring that you receive the proper care, in the right place, at the right time. They will handle recommendations to board-certified specialized providers that can best meet your needs.

One of the most important methods to ensure good long-term care with your physician is to make sure they are someone you feel at ease with and trust. And that you are working together to reach the same goal: to help you attain your best overall health and well-being.

Aside from delivering direct care, primary care providers work hard to improve the healthcare system. We are working hard behind the scenes at Hale Family Practice to enhance numerous elements of care for our patients, including prices, access, and processes.

The next time you consider not seeing a primary care provider because you are feeling well, remember that one of the best ways to love and take care of yourself is to develop a habit of annually visiting your trusted health clinic.
